HDB Sales Brochure Part 1 of 2:

UrbanVille @ Woodlands

 

Bounded by Woodlands Avenue 2 and Avenue 5, UrbanVille @ Woodlands is located close to amenities such as Causeway Point and Woodlands Civic Centre. The overall pedestrian connectivity within the development is further enhanced by the integration of the WoodsVista Gallery which serves as a pedestrian and cycling link to eventually connect to Woodlands MRT station and the Woodlands Waterfront. In addition, UrbanVille @ Woodlands will be well-connected by various overhead pedestrian links across major roads. The development comprises 8 residential blocks with heights ranging from 14 to 32 storeys.

UrbanVille @ Woodlands will have a distinctive profile, with a sky bridge located at the 24th storey offering panoramic views of the town. Sky terraces at some residential blocks and roof gardens at all residential blocks will create a relaxing and welcoming environment. Poised to inject new vitality into the area, its name reflects its identity as a vibrant residential hub.

UrbanVille @ Woodlands houses a multitude of outdoor facilities such as playgrounds, fitness stations, and a hard court. Alternatively, you can choose to spend some quiet time at the roof garden above the Multi-Storey Car Park.

A supermarket, eating house, restaurants, shops, childcare centre and Residents' Committee Centre will also be located within UrbanVille @ Woodlands.

You can choose from 1,785 units of 2-room Flexi, 3-, 4-, and 5-room flats.

Case Study 1B: Plight of residents of HDB Yuhua BTO which was installed also with the Pneumatic Waste Collection System (PWCS).

9. As expected. It takes just one or two inconsiderate residents to make a mess of this system...

10. Imagine 4 years and more of tolerance.

11. Residents reported:-

12. Persistent odour

13. Foul smell exuding from the centralised bin centre at Blk 223A of Jurong East Street 21 has been a persistent problem in Yuhua since the PWCS started.

14. According to a recent report from the Chinese evening newspaper Lianhe Wanbao, residents have been bearing with the smelly environment for the past four years.

15. Some residents also feedback of bulky items such as large soft toys, cardboards and mattresses, which choke up the pipe network. The cleaners will have to manually clear these items from the PWCS.

16. The success depends on the users of the PWCS.

17. There is no other choice for such estates.

Case Study 2B: Stack 337 main entrance door faces the emergency exit staircase door. Should I be concerned with this?

332786705_stairwellandstack337.png.5d70dade84692f88117aa5e535f45c80.png1. In Feng Shui, it is considered inauspicious for the main door to face a staircase. As this symbolises wealth flowing down the stairs.

2. Fortunately one has the backing of the law.

2.1. Due to the Singapore Fire Safety code, all emergency staircase doors must always be closed at all times. 

2.2. Thus no one or estate personnel should not be allowed to leave this staircase door open. It must be closed at all times.

Case Study 7: Potential sha qi or poison arrow from Drop of Point (DOP) roof-line aimed towards 2nd storey units

1. A sample of one of the DOP at Urbanville shows that it is rather imposing:

1. 170689737_potentialshaqifromroof-lineofDOP.png.f779237a562a852589f5d3f4ab2087e7.png

2. Most concern usually is the 2nd storey units. As often, the roof-line of such a DOP is able to become a poison arrow and "slice" towards virtually the entire frontage of the 2nd storey unit.

3. For example, most likely it will slice through that of stack 119. As for stacks 139 and 149, most likely such a poison arrow is aimed towards the 2nd storey living room and even maybe bedroom 3 windows.

3.1. It is difficult to cure if this roof-line becomes a poison arrow aimed towards a living room window(s).
